Note: Note the following regarding pin names. For details, see section 1.5, Pin Assignments.
 We recommend using pins that have a letter (“-A”, “-B”, etc.) to indicate group membership appended to their names as groups.
For the RSPI, QSPI, SDHI, and MMC interfaces, the AC portion of the electrical characteristics is measured for each group.
 Pins that have "-DS" appended to their names can be used as triggers for release from deep software standby.
 RIIC pin functions that have [FM+] appended to their names support fast-mode plus.
